TL;DR: 끊임없는 기술 발전의 세계에서 복잡한 기술을 빠르게 습득하는 능력은 더 이상 사치가 아니라 전략적 필수 요소입니다.
특히 기술 분야의 변화의 속도는 지속적이고 빠른 학습에 대한 헌신을 요구합니다. 단순히 따라잡는 것만으로는 어려운 일이며, 진정한 리더십을 발휘하려면 새로운 기술과 패러다임을 탁월한 속도와 효율성으로 습득해야 합니다. 그래서 저는 1년 만에 4개 국어를 배우고 MIT의 엄격한 4년제 컴퓨터 과학 커리큘럼을 단 12개월 만에 수료하는 등 속진 학습 분야에서 놀라운 성과를 거둔 스콧 영의 사례를 소개합니다.
그의 저서 "울트라러닝"에 자세히 설명된 접근 방식은 전통적인 의미의 지름길이 아니라 어려운 기술을 효과적으로 습득하기 위한 전략적이고 강도 높은 방법론에 관한 것입니다. 머큐리 테크놀로지 솔루션에서 '디지털 가속화'를 위해 노력하는 만큼 이러한 원칙을 이해하고 적용하는 것은 개인의 성장과 조직의 민첩성 모두를 위해 필수적입니다. 제가 생각하기에 엄청난 가치를 지닌 다섯 가지 기본 울트라러닝 원칙을 살펴보겠습니다.
울트라러닝의 포장 풀기: 빠른 기술 습득을 위한 5가지 기본 원칙
스콧 영이 9가지 원칙을 설명했지만, 저는 오늘날 전문가와 기업에게 특히 공감이 가고 실행 가능한 5가지 원칙에 초점을 맞추고자 합니다:
1. 메타인지(메타스티어링): 먼저, 학습 지도 그리기
새로운 학습에 뛰어들기 전에 어떤 준비를 하나요? 많은 사람들이 직관적으로 주제를 선택하고 인기 있는 온라인 강좌를 구입한 후 바로 뛰어들기도 합니다. 하지만 이러한 접근 방식은 종종 선택한 커리큘럼이 자신의 구체적인 필요와 목표에 진정으로 부합하는지에 대한 고민을 남깁니다.
울트라러닝은 보다 전략적인 첫 단계를 옹호합니다: <메타인지, 즉 "학습에 대한 학습"을 강조합니다 여기에는 세 가지 질문을 철저하게 해결하여 나만의 맞춤형 학습 지도를 만드는 것이 포함됩니다:
- 왜요? 핵심 동기는 무엇인가요? 도구적 동기(예: 특정 프로젝트나 역할을 위해 새로운 기술이 필요함)인가요, 아니면 내재적 동기(배우고 싶은 마음속 깊은 곳의 열망)인가요? '왜'를 명확히 하면 집중력을 높일 수 있고 그 기술이 진정으로 목표에 도움이 되는지 판단하는 데 도움이 됩니다. 도구적 목표의 경우, 전문가와의 인터뷰를 통해 올바른 기술을 목표로 삼고 있는지 확인할 수 있습니다. 내재적 목표의 경우, "이것을 어떻게 적용할 수 있을까요?"라고 질문하면 목표를 구체화하는 데 도움이 됩니다.
- 무엇? 이 기술에는 어떤 구체적인 지식과 능력이 필요하나요? 세분화하세요:
- 개념: 깊은 이해가 필요한 아이디어 및 원칙(예: 소프트웨어 개발에서는 객체 지향 프로그래밍 원칙이나 데이터베이스 정규화 등이 될 수 있음).
- 팩트: 암기해야 하는 정보(예: 새로운 프로그래밍 언어의 구문 규칙, 업계별 약어).
- 프로세스: 거의 자동이 될 때까지 연습이 필요한 작업(예: 일반적인 코딩 패턴, 디버깅 루틴, 애플리케이션 배포).
- 어떻게요? 어떤 자료와 방법을 사용하시나요? 학문적 과목의 경우, 대학에서 제공하는 입문 과정의 강의 계획서가 매우 유용할 수 있습니다. 학문적이지 않은 기술의 경우 온라인(Reddit과 같은 포럼은 금광이 될 수 있음)이나 직접 찾아가서 전문가에게 조언을 구하세요.
이 초기 매핑을 통해 학습 여정을 목적에 맞게 효율적으로 진행할 수 있습니다.
2. 집중력: 깊은 집중력 키우기
초연결 세상에서 깊이 집중하는 능력은 초능력입니다. Scott Young은 미루기(시작하기 어려움), 주의 산만(집중력 유지 어려움), '깊은' 집중력 부족(피상적 참여)이라는 세 가지 공통된 집중력 장애를 지적합니다.
미루는 습관은 종종 더 매력적인 일을 하고 싶은 욕망이나 당면한 업무의 부적절함에 대한 두려움에서 비롯됩니다. 이를 극복하기 위한 첫 번째 단계는 솔직하게 인정하는 것입니다. 영은 집중력을 키우기 위한 평준화된 접근 방식을 제안합니다:
- 1단계(불쾌감 해소하기): 작업이 부담스럽게 느껴진다면 "5분"만을 목표로 삼으세요 초기 마찰을 줄이면 추진력을 키우는 데 도움이 되는 경우가 많습니다.
- 2단계(잦은 휴식 관리): 포모도로 기법을 사용하여 25분 동안 집중해서 일한 후 5분간 휴식을 취합니다.
- 3단계(더 깊은 집중력 달성하기): '시간 차단'을 사용하여 하루를 미리 계획하고 학습이나 업무에 집중할 수 있도록 방해받지 않는 구체적인 시간 블록을 할당하세요. 유연성을 발휘하는 것이 중요하며, 더 높은 수준의 기술이 효과가 없다면 더 간단한 방법으로 되돌려 습관을 다시 구축하세요.
3. 직접성: 실제 일을 해보며 배우기
기존의 많은 학습은 말하지 않고 언어의 문법 규칙을 배우고, 발표하지 않고 대중 연설에 관한 책을 읽는 등 간접적인 방법을 사용합니다. <강한>직접성의 원칙은 학습 활동이 궁극적으로 그 기술이 사용될 맥락과 밀접하게 반영되어야 한다고 주장합니다. 본질적으로, 진정한 학습은 자신이 하고 싶은 일을 직접 해보는 것입니다.
새로운 언어를 유창하게 구사하는 것이 목표라면 교과서 연습에만 의존하는 것보다 원어민과 실제 대화에 참여하는 것이 훨씬 더 효과적입니다. 직접 학습을 위한 효과적인 방법은 다음과 같습니다:
- 프로젝트 기반 학습: 특정 결과물(예: 앱 만들기, 일련의 기사 작성, 시스템 설계)을 중심으로 학습을 구성합니다. 이는 엔지니어링, 디자인, 콘텐츠 제작과 같은 기술에 매우 효과적입니다. Mercury의 팀은 내부 기술 개발에 이 접근법을 자주 사용하며, 새로운 지식을 실제로 적용할 수 있도록 단계별 결과물을 설정합니다.
- 몰입 학습: 기술을 사용해야 하는 환경에 자신을 배치합니다(예: 새로운 코딩 프레임워크를 배우기 위해 오픈 소스 프로젝트에 참여).
- "비행 시뮬레이터" 방법: 직접적인 몰입이 즉시 가능하지 않은 경우, 기술의 실제 적용을 최대한 가깝게 시뮬레이션하는 환경을 만들거나 찾아보세요.
4. 훈련: 약점 고립 및 정복하기
복잡한 기술은 서로 연결된 많은 구성 요소로 이루어져 있습니다. 이 중 한두 가지 영역의 약점으로 인해 발전이 병목되는 경우가 종종 있습니다. 예를 들어, 새로운 프로그래밍 언어를 배울 때 핵심 라이브러리 기능에 익숙하지 않은 것이 큰 걸림돌이 될 수 있습니다.
드릴링은 이러한 약점을 파악하고, 이를 가장 작은 구성 요소로 세분화하여 집중적으로 연습하는 것을 포함합니다. 스콧 영이 몇 가지 효과적인 훈련 기법을 제안합니다:
- 시간 분할: 더 큰 절차의 특정 부분을 분리하여 반복적으로 연습합니다(예: 특정 코딩 알고리즘이나 복잡한 Git 워크플로 연습).
- 인지적 연습: 작업에 여러 인지 능력이 필요한 경우 한 번에 하나씩만 연습하는 데 집중하세요(예: 새로운 데이터 시각화 기술을 배울 때는 미적 표현에 신경 쓰기 전에 차트의 구조를 이해하는 데만 집중하세요).
- 모방(모방 방법): 전문가 작업의 특정 부분을 모방하여 기본 메커니즘을 이해합니다(예: 자신의 기술 문서 작성을 개선하기 위해 잘 만들어진 API 문서를 해체하고 재작성).
- 돋보기 방법: 창의력이나 문제 해결 능력의 경우, 개선하려는 특정 단계에 불균형적으로 더 많은 시간을 투자하세요(예: 확장 가능한 시스템을 설계하는 능력을 향상하려면 실습 프로젝트의 시스템 설계 단계에 더 많은 시간을 투자하세요).
- 전제 조건 연쇄: 스킬 연습에 바로 뛰어들었다가 지식이나 구성 요소 스킬의 공백이 생기면 잠시 멈추고 해당 전제 조건을 학습한 후 계속 진행하세요.
5. 검색: 기억력 강화를 위한 능동적 리콜
우리는 모두 '망각 곡선'의 영향을 받아 정보를 학습한 후 얼마 지나지 않아 자연스럽게 잊어버리기 시작합니다. 이를 극복하고 지속적인 지식을 구축하려면 <강력한> 능동적 검색에 참여해야 합니다. 즉, 수동적으로 정보를 검토하는 것이 아니라 기억에서 정보를 강제로 불러오는 것입니다.
심리학자 R.A. 비요크가 말한 것처럼, '바람직한 어려움'(무언가를 떠올리기 위해 애쓰다가 결국 성공하는 것)을 겪으면 장기 기억력이 크게 강화됩니다. 효과적인 검색 방법에는 다음이 포함됩니다:
- 플래시카드: 사실적인 정보(예: 프로그래밍 구문, 키보드 단축키, 기술 정의)를 암기하는 데 탁월합니다. Anki와 같은 도구는 간격 반복 원칙에 따라 복습 일정을 최적화하기도 합니다.
- 자유 회상: 챕터를 읽거나 튜토리얼을 보거나 회의에 참석한 후, 잠시 시간을 내어 기억나는 모든 것을 적거나 말로 표현해 보세요. 이것은 강력한 자가 테스트 방법입니다. 신기술 요약본의 핵심 개념을 기억하지 못한다면 그 개념을 제대로 내면화하지 못했다는 신호입니다.
- 자생적 과제: 실무 기술을 위해 배운 내용을 바탕으로 스스로 작은 과제나 연습 문제를 만들어 보세요(예: "방금 공부한 새로운 디자인 패턴을 사용하여 이 코드를 리팩터링하기" 또는 "세미나에서 논의한 전략적 프레임워크를 사용하여 X 클라이언트 문제에 대한 해결책 개요 작성하기").
실제 울트라러닝: 머큐리 관점
이러한 초학습 원칙은 단순한 학문적 개념이 아니라 조직의 문화에 내재화하여 빠른 혁신과 적응력을 키울 수 있는 실용적인 전략입니다. 머큐리 테크놀로지 솔루션에서는 직원들이 새로운 기술적 과제를 직접적으로 해결하고, 핵심 문제 해결에 집중하며, 지속적으로 지식을 검색하고 적용하여 더 깊은 전문성을 쌓을 수 있도록 장려합니다. 이러한 학습 민첩성은 고객과 우리 자신을 위한 '디지털 가속화' 능력의 기본입니다. 머큐리 뮤즈 AI와 같은 AI 솔루션도 방대한 데이터 세트와 피드백을 기반으로 반복적인 학습과 개선의 원칙을 기반으로 구축되었습니다.
기술의 반감기가 줄어들고 있는 시대에 울트라러닝을 위한 역량은 엄청난 경쟁 우위입니다.
이러한 원칙을 살펴보고 여러분 자신과 조직의 학습 궤도를 어떻게 변화시킬 수 있을지 생각해 보시기 바랍니다. 미래는 새로운 영역을 빠르고 깊이 있게 배우고 적응하며 마스터할 수 있는 사람들의 것입니다.